Clothes And Accessories For Winter

Skating in the winter can be a thrilling experience, but it’s essential to stay warm and safe in colder temperatures. To help you defy the cold and continue enjoying your cold-months ride sessions, here’s a guide to selecting the right cold season attire:

Wear the right skateboarding apparel in winter
source: wallpaperflare.com
  1. Insulated Jacket or Hoodie: Invest in a high-quality insulated jacket or hoodie and other skateboarding apparel that provides warmth and wind protection, especially during winter. Look for materials for your apparel like fleece, down, or synthetic insulation. A hood can help keep your head and ears warm during winter sessions.
  2. Layering: Layering your apparel is key to staying warm during winter, especially when skateboarding. Wear a thermal or moisture-wicking base layer apparel to keep sweat away from your skin, a middle layer for insulation, and a waterproof or water-resistant outer layer to protect against snow and rain.
  3. Beanie or Hat: A beanie or a hat is essential for keeping your head and ears warm during your winter skateboarding sessions. Look for beanies made from materials like wool or fleece, which provide excellent insulation, especially for winter skateboarding sessions.
  4. Gloves or Mittens: Protect your hands from the winter cold by wearing gloves or mittens. Look for options that are thin enough to maintain dexterity while skateboarding but also insulated to keep your hands warm.
  5. Thermal Socks: Invest in winter apparel for skateboarding like thermal socks that wick moisture away from your feet while providing extra insulation. Keeping your feet warm is crucial when skateboarding during the winter season.
  6. Thermal Underwear: Thermal apparel or long underwear is essential for keeping your legs warm during winter. Look for options that are comfortable, moisture-wicking, and provide good insulation.
  7. Shoes: Choose skateboarding shoes that are appropriate for winter conditions. Look for skateboarding shoes with weather-resistant or waterproof features, as they can help keep your feet dry and warm during winter or wet weather.
  8. Waterproof Pants: Opt for waterproof or water-resistant apparel to keep yourself dry in winter or rainy conditions. Make sure they are comfortable and allow you to move freely while skating.
  9. Neck Warmer or Scarf: A neck warmer or scarf can help protect your neck and lower face from chilly winter winds and cold air.
  10. Goggles or Sunglasses: Protect your eyes from snow glare and winter wind by wearing goggles or sunglasses designed for winter sports.
  11. Helmet: Never forget your skateboarding helmet, regardless of the season. Protecting your head is crucial, especially during slippery conditions.
  12. Deck Grip Tape: During the winter season, grip tape on your skateboard can get damp and lose its traction. Consider applying clear skateboard grip tape or grip-enhancing products to maintain a good grip on your skateboard.

Remember to dress appropriately for the specific cold weather conditions in your area. If the cold weather becomes severe or unsafe, consider postponing your session for another day. Prioritize safety while enjoying your favorite sport during the colder months.

Are Joggers Good To Wear When Skating?

Joggers can be suitable for skating, but their effectiveness depends on personal preferences and the style of the activity. Joggers are comfortable and offer a relaxed fit, which allows for ease of movement while performing tricks and maneuvers. Their tapered design around the ankles may prevent them from getting caught in the skateboard’s truck wheels, reducing the risk of skateboarding accidents. However, some skaters prefer more fitted pants shorts, or jeans to have better visibility of their feet and board. Additionally, joggers may not provide as much protection from scrapes and falls as thicker skate-specific pants. Ultimately, the decision to wear joggers for skateboarding comes down to individual comfort and style preferences, but it’s essential to ensure they won’t hinder your performance or safety on the skateboard.

Can I Wear Jeans To Ice Skating?

Yes, you can wear jeans to ice skating, but they may not be the ideal choice of clothing for the activity. Jeans can restrict movement and become uncomfortable when they get wet from the ice or sweat. They also do not provide much insulation, which can be a concern if you are ice skating in colder temperatures.

For a more comfortable and suitable option, it’s recommended to wear athletic pants or leggings made from moisture-wicking and thermal materials. These types of pants allow for better freedom of movement and keep you warm and dry during your ice skating session. Additionally, considering the new advancements in thermal clothing technology, you can layer up with thermal tops and a warm jacket to stay comfortable on the ice. What Is Skating On Snow Called?

Snowboarding is a popular snow-season sport and recreational activity where participants ride a board similar to a skateboard but specifically designed for cold-season use. Snowboards have bindings that secure the rider’s feet to the board, allowing them to navigate down snow-covered slopes. The sport was inspired by skate and surfing, combining elements of both to create a unique and exhilarating experience on the snow.

Snowboarding can be enjoyed on various terrains, including mountains, hills, and specially designed snow parks. It has become a popular cold season activity worldwide, with many enthusiasts enjoying the freedom and excitement of riding down snowy slopes. The sport offers a wide range of styles, from freestyle tricks in snow parks to backcountry riding in natural snow settings, making it appealing to a diverse audience of thrill-seekers and outdoor enthusiasts.
